Output 733ffb2364972961b4051b2fafb4e7b387312b861977c2c44ba336c3efa9a4e7:1

value
12286917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d8b94bacf0529d90a2cee69418fde46f1c2f90 OP_EQUAL
address
37Ek6HevrU5vks4NCJwdhthyXiLz2Sy7oj
transaction
733ffb2364972961b4051b2fafb4e7b387312b861977c2c44ba336c3efa9a4e7
confirmations
332078
spent
true